深入了解Shadowsocks与GFW及PAC的关系

在当今信息化时代,网络安全与隐私保护愈发受到重视。在中国,网络监控与审查行为十分普遍,其中最为人知的便是GFW(Great Firewall)。而Shadowsocks作为一种翻墙工具,其使用者逐渐增多。在这样的背景下,PAC(Proxy Auto-Config)文件也逐渐被广泛讨论。本文将全面探讨Shadowsocks与GFW、PAC之间的关系与使用技巧。

什么是Shadowsocks?

Shadowsocks是一款基于SOCKS5代理的开源翻墙工具,其主要功能是实现科学上网,帮助用户绕过网络审查,访问被屏蔽的网站。其核心特点包括:

  • 加密传输:提供数据加密,保障用户隐私。
  • 高效稳定:相比其他翻墙工具,Shadowsocks在速度与稳定性上表现突出。
  • 易于使用:Shadowsocks的配置较为简单,适合普通用户。

GFW的影响

GFW(Great Firewall)是中国政府实施的一种网络审查机制,通过技术手段对国际互联网进行限制和过滤,主要影响有:

  • 阻断特定网站:例如,Google、Facebook、Twitter等。
  • 内容过滤:根据关键词过滤信息。
  • 限速与延迟:影响翻墙工具的速度与稳定性。

PAC的概念

PAC(Proxy Auto-Config)文件是一种自动配置代理的技术,通过设置特定的规则,决定请求通过哪一个代理服务器。它的主要优势包括:

  • 自动化管理:用户无需手动切换代理,便可根据不同网站自动选择。
  • 灵活性:可根据不同条件,灵活配置不同的代理策略。

Shadowsocks与GFW的关系

Shadowsocks作为翻墙工具,旨在对抗GFW的网络审查。其工作原理为:

  • 用户在本地配置Shadowsocks客户端,连接至可用的服务器。
  • 所有流量通过加密通道发送,降低被GFW检测到的风险。
  • 对于某些网站,通过PAC文件的设置,用户可以根据需要选择是否走代理。

如何使用Shadowsocks与PAC

  1. 安装Shadowsocks:根据操作系统下载相应版本的Shadowsocks客户端,进行安装。
  2. 配置服务器信息:填写服务器地址、端口、密码及加密方式等信息。
  3. 配置PAC文件:将PAC文件链接输入到Shadowsocks设置中,以实现自动代理配置。
  4. 测试连接:确保连接正常后,可以尝试访问被封锁的网站。

Shadowsocks的常见配置

  • 服务器地址:这是Shadowsocks连接的关键,需要保证地址的有效性。
  • 端口:通常使用1080、8388等,需根据服务器提供的信息填写。
  • 密码:设置一个复杂的密码,以确保安全性。
  • 加密方式:常用的加密方式有aes-256-gcm等。

常见问题解答

1. Shadowsocks安全吗?

Shadowsocks通过加密技术保障用户隐私,但用户在使用时需选择可信赖的服务器,以免信息泄露。

2. 如何选择Shadowsocks服务器?

选择Shadowsocks服务器时,建议考虑以下因素:

  • 地理位置:选择离自己最近的服务器以降低延迟。
  • 稳定性:查看该服务器的使用评价与稳定性。
  • 速度:选择提供高带宽的服务器。

3. PAC文件的优势是什么?

PAC文件的主要优势在于它能够根据用户的需求,自动选择代理,极大地提升了用户的上网体验。

4. 使用Shadowsocks会被检测到吗?

虽然Shadowsocks采用加密传输,降低了被检测的风险,但仍然可能受到GFW的监控,因此用户需定期更新服务器信息。

总结

Shadowsocks与GFW的斗争是一场持久战。使用PAC文件能够提高Shadowsocks的灵活性,使得翻墙更加高效。希望本文能帮助您更好地理解Shadowsocks、GFW及PAC的关系,并提升您的网络使用体验。

正文完